Abstract

A turbo refrigerator includes a centrifugal compressor configured to compress a refrigerant by rotation of an impeller having a plurality of blades, a condenser configured to cool the compressed refrigerant, a first expansion valve and a second expansion valve connected in series and configured to decompress the refrigerant from the condenser to form two phases of a gas and a liquid, an evaporator configured to evaporate the refrigerant from the second expansion valve, an economizer disposed between the first expansion valve and the second expansion valve and configured to separate the refrigerant into two phases of a gas and a liquid, and an introduction path configured to allow the gas phase separated from the refrigerant in the economizer to flow between a front edge and a rear edge of a blade in a main flow channel between the neighboring blades of the impeller.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
1 . A turbo refrigerator comprising:
 a centrifugal compressor configured to compress a refrigerant by rotation of an impeller having a plurality of blades;   a condenser configured to cool the compressed refrigerant;   a plurality of decompressors configured to decompress the refrigerant from the condenser to form two phases of a gas and a liquid and connected to each other in series in a number greater than the number of stages of the centrifugal compressor;   an evaporator configured to evaporate the refrigerant passing through the plurality of decompressors;   gas-liquid separators disposed between the decompressors and configured to separate the refrigerant into the two phases of the gas and the liquid; and   an introduction path configured to cause the gas phase separated from the refrigerant to flow between a front edge and a rear edge between the neighboring blades in at least one of the gas-liquid separators.   
     
     
         2 . The turbo refrigerator according to  claim 1 , wherein the introduction path allows the gas phase to flow closer to the front edge side than an intermediate section between the front edge and the rear edge of the blade. 
     
     
         3 . The turbo refrigerator according to  claim 1 , wherein the introduction path allows the gas phase to flow in a flowing direction of the refrigerant on a meridional plane of the impeller. 
     
     
         4 . The turbo refrigerator according to  claim 1 , wherein the introduction path comprises a guide vane formed parallel to the blade on an inner circumferential surface of the introduction path. 
     
     
         5 . The turbo refrigerator according to  claim 1 , wherein an end section of the blade side of the introduction path has a diameter that gradually increases downstream.
